Two's Complement cover image

Carbon Footprint

Two's Complement

CHAPTER

The Evolution of Programming Languages and Carbon's Emergence

This chapter explores the attributes and performance criteria necessary for a programming language to succeed C++. It highlights various languages like Rust, Swift, and introduces Carbon as a modern alternative, emphasizing its aim to improve upon C++'s features while facilitating interoperability. The discussion also addresses community influence in language design, memory management nuances, and generics optimization, showcasing the complexities of modern programming languages.

00:00
Transcript
Play full episode

Remember Everything You Learn from Podcasts

Save insights instantly, chat with episodes, and build lasting knowledge - all powered by AI.
App store bannerPlay store banner